Possible Points of Canonical Wnt Inhibition.
Published 2015“…Non canonical signalling is inhibitory to canonical signalling (2) Decreased Fzd receptor expression, reducing response to canonical ligands secreted by other cells (3) Increased sFRP expression (4) Increased expression of other morphogens such as Notch, able to directly inhibit βCatenin. …”

CD43<sup>-/-</sup> septic mice exhibit decreased frequencies of apoptotic CD8<sup>+</sup> T<sub>EM</sub> as compared to WT septic mice.
Published 2018“…D) There was a significant decrease in apoptosis of CD44<sup>HI</sup> CD62L<sup>LO</sup> CD8<sup>+</sup> T<sub>EM</sub> in CD43<sup>-/-</sup> septic mice compared to WT septic mice (10.3±1.1 vs 17.9±1.9, p = 0.006). …”

Image_1_Loss of early B cell protein λ5 decreases bone mass and accelerates skeletal aging.jpeg
Published 2023“…The trabecular bone volume over total volume (BV/TV) in J<sub>H</sub><sup>-/-</sup> mice was similar to WT mice at all ages. In contrast, at six months of age and thereafter, λ5<sup>-/-</sup> and J<sub>H</sub><sup>-/-</sup>λ5<sup>-/-</sup> mice demonstrated a severe decrease in trabecular bone mass. …”
